Checking the drive of the outside rearview mirrors [Toyota RAV4 XA10]

Figure 15.59. Location of exterior rearview mirror control components: 1 – electric motors located in the mirror housings; 2 – ECU unit located on the front passenger side; 3 – ignition switch; 4 – switch for adjusting the position of the outside mirrors; 5 – driver's side fuse box


To adjust the position of each exterior rearview mirror, two electric motors are used: one for adjustment in the vertical plane, the second - in the horizontal plane (figure 15.59).

The switch has a selector that supplies voltage to either the right or left mirror.

Check the drive of the outside rearview mirrors as follows.

Turn on the ignition without starting the engine. Lower the front windows and alternately turn the mirrors in the vertical and horizontal planes, listening to the sound of the running engines.

If the motor is running but the mirror does not move, the mirror drive mechanism may be faulty. Remove and disassemble the mirror to determine the cause of the malfunction.

If the mirrors do not move and you cannot hear the motors running, check the integrity of the fuse.

If the fuse is good, remove the switch from the instrument panel and check its condition.



In accordance with the electrical diagrams, check the reliability of the connection of the mirror wires connected to the ground.

If the mirror still does not work, remove it and check the power supply to the mirror.

If there is no voltage even in one switch position, check the electrical circuit between the mirror and the switch.

If voltage is present in all operating positions of the switch, remove the mirror and check the functionality of the electric motors by connecting them with additional wires to the battery. If the motors do not work, replace the mirror.
